PiTiVi featured on linux.com
There is an interesting piece of news about PiTiVi that it is being offered funding for development by Collabora. Following the hiring of PiTiVi project leader, Edward Hervey Collabora has also hired Branden Lewis ( My colleague for google summer of code work with PiTiVi ) for part time.

PiTiVi
Pitivi is a very promising Open Source video editor software. It is based on Gstreamer, Gnonlin development libs.
Please have a look at PiTiVi.org
It is still under initial stages of development. Hence it still requires lots of features to be added to be used a professional video editing software. As the part of Google Summer of Code 2008, I am working with PiTiVi to add certain features like record from webcam, capturing network stream etc.
